Why should you go for private label lipsticks?

  • Unique shades and formulae: You have the opportunity to develop distinctive lipstick formulations and hues customized to your desired consumer group. Distinguish yourself from others and establish a truly unique brand!
  • Building an outstanding brand: Custom branding allows you to personalize all elements of your lipstick collection, encompassing the item and the wrapping, displaying your brand’s identity and flair.
  • Boosting profit margins: Deciding to go for a private brand lipstick enables you to earn greater profits as opposed to searching for components and vendors independently. As you’re cutting expenses on research and development, you’ll be able to regulate the prices, leading to more money in your pocket!

How to choose a manufacturer for your lipstick line?

  • Company should have expertise in lipstick manufacturing

It is vital to have a manufacturer with a demonstrated history of success in the field. They must possess expertise in producing diverse lipstick variations (such as matte, satin, and sheer) and have the ability to assist you throughout the complete procedure. It is imperative to ensure that the manufacturers have a specialization in color cosmetics.

  • Manufacturers should offer a variety of options

Search for a manufacturer that provides an extensive variety of lip color choices and components.  No matter if you desire vegan, ethically-made, or all-natural recipes, they should have everything you need.  Verifying this information in advance will help you save a significant amount of time before engaging with private label manufacturers.

Advertisement
  • Certificates and compliance

Make certain that your producer follows the guidelines and complies with the industry norms, such as adhering to the FDA standards for beauty products or complying with the European Cosmetics Regulations, based on your intended audience. Additionally, they must possess the required certifications to support their assertions. Step-by-step guide to creating a private label lipstick

Step1: Choosing the shades and types of lipsticks

Advertisement

To begin with, establish the categories of lipsticks that you wish to include in your product range such as matte, glossy, or long-wearing. Afterward, choose a color scheme that mirrors your brand identity and captivates your intended customers. Incorporating contemporary hues with timeless shades is an excellent approach to satisfy varying preferences.

Step 2: Selecting ingredients and colors

Presently, collaborate with your producer to select the appropriate components and compositions for your lipsticks. Consider aspects such as longevity, consistency, and moisturization. Additional credit can be earned by incorporating beneficial components such as vitamins or antioxidants!

Advertisement

Step 3: Lipstick packaging

It’s not just about safeguarding the merchandise; it’s equally an influential means of branding. Ensure that the packaging of your lipstick mirrors your brand’s style and captivates your intended consumers. The shape, dimensions, constituents, and emblems – every single aspect holds significance!
